Responsibilities
- Design and implement novel quantum algorithms for optimization and simulation
- Lead experimental quantum computing projects using 50+ qubit systems
- Collaborate with AI/ML teams to develop hybrid quantum-classical solutions
- Publish breakthrough research in top-tier journals and conferences
- Secure $2M+ in research grants through proposal development
- Mentor PhD candidates and junior researchers
- Drive commercialization of quantum technologies through industry partnerships
Qualifications
- PhD in Physics, Computer Science, or related field (or equivalent experience)
- 3+ years hands-on quantum computing research experience
- Proficiency in quantum programming languages (Q#, Qiskit, Cirq)
- Strong background in quantum error correction and fault tolerance
- Track record of peer-reviewed publications in quantum computing
- Expertise in at least one classical high-performance computing framework
- Experience with quantum hardware interfaces (IBM, Rigetti, IonQ)
